Latest Patents: Gayathri holds a patent for a groundbreaking invention titled "System for Eliminating Secondary Images in Rear Projection Systems." This invention provides a secondary image suppression system (SISS) designed to minimize ghost images that can distort the viewing experience. The system incorporates a circular polarizing assembly that includes a linear polarizer and a quarter wave retarder. By effectively managing internal reflections and directing light through a high power Fresnel lens toward the viewing screen, the SISS enhances image quality by eliminating significant secondary ghost images. This innovative approach can be further optimized when combined with a high contrast screen assembly.
